MySQL 删除触发器的步骤

在MySQL数据库中,触发器(Trigger)是一种特殊的存储过程,它会在指定的数据库操作(例如插入、更新、删除)发生时自动执行。如果我们需要删除一个已经存在的触发器,可以按照以下步骤进行操作:

步骤 描述
1 连接到MySQL数据库
2 查看已经存在的触发器
3 删除指定的触发器

1. 连接到MySQL数据库

首先,我们需要使用合适的凭据(用户名和密码)连接到MySQL数据库。可以使用以下代码连接到数据库:

mysql -u username -p

其中,username 是数据库用户名,-p 表示需要输入密码。

2. 查看已经存在的触发器

在删除触发器之前,我们需要先查看已经存在的触发器,确定要删除的触发器名称。可以使用以下代码查看已经存在的触发器:

SHOW TRIGGERS;

执行上述命令后,会列出数据库中所有的触发器。通过观察,找到要删除的触发器名称。

3. 删除指定的触发器

一旦确定要删除的触发器名称,我们可以使用以下代码来删除触发器:

DROP TRIGGER trigger_name;

其中,trigger_name 是要删除的触发器名称。

执行以上命令后,数据库会删除指定的触发器。

完整示例

下面是一个完整的示例,展示如何删除一个名为 my_trigger 的触发器:

  1. 使用以下命令连接到MySQL数据库:
mysql -u username -p
  1. 在MySQL命令行中,使用以下命令查看已经存在的触发器:
SHOW TRIGGERS;
  1. 在触发器列表中找到要删除的触发器名称,例如 my_trigger

  2. 使用以下命令删除触发器:

DROP TRIGGER my_trigger;

执行以上命令后,触发器 my_trigger 将被成功删除。

总结

删除MySQL触发器的过程包括连接到数据库、查看已存在的触发器以及删除指定的触发器。通过以上步骤和示例,我们可以轻松地删除不再需要的触发器。请注意,删除触发器是一个敏感操作,务必谨慎执行。

希望本文对你理解和学习如何删除MySQL触发器有所帮助!